Why Lower Cutoff Colleges Still Deliver High ROI

Many students mistakenly equate high admission cutoffs exclusively with career success. In the realm of Data Science, the curriculum's practical application, faculty expertise, and industry partnerships often outweigh the prestige of a high entrance rank. Institutions with moderate cutoffs frequently invest heavily in industry-ready labs and NASSCOM-aligned certifications to remain competitive. When evaluating these colleges, look beyond the entrance exam score and focus on the 'hidden' metrics: the frequency of industry-sponsored projects, the availability of cloud computing infrastructure, and the specific companies visiting for campus drives. A college with a lower cutoff that maintains a strong relationship with local tech hubs can often provide better networking opportunities than an elite institution with an isolated academic environment. Prioritize programs that emphasize Python, R, SQL, and Deep Learning frameworks over purely theoretical mathematics.

Verifying Institutional Quality and Placement Records

To ensure your chosen college is worth the investment, verify all claims against official institutional prospectuses and NIRF statutory data. While elite institutions like IIT Guwahati (2026 cutoff 294) and IISc Bangalore (JAM cutoff 150-250) set the benchmark, mid-tier universities often publish transparent placement reports that offer a clearer picture of actual student outcomes. Always cross-reference the average package figures provided in brochures with LinkedIn alumni data. If a university claims a high placement rate, verify if those roles are in core Data Science or generic IT support. Official AICTE and UGC disclosures are your best defense against inflated marketing claims. Step-by-Step Practical Decision Framework

Actionable steps to evaluate institutions before applying

1Step 1

Audit the Curriculum

Ensure the syllabus covers modern stacks like PyTorch, TensorFlow, and MLOps, not just legacy statistics.

2Step 2

Verify Placement Data

Request the list of companies that visited for campus drives in the last two years; ignore 'highest package' marketing and focus on the median.

3Step 3

Calculate Real ROI

Divide the total cost of the program by the average starting salary to determine your payback period.

Frequently Asked Questions

Clear answers to common student admission questions

Is an MSc in Data Science from a low-cutoff college valuable?
Yes, provided the curriculum focuses on practical skills and the college maintains active industry partnerships for placements.
What is the typical fee range for MSc Data Science in India?
Fees generally range from ₹1.5L to ₹6L for the entire two-year program, depending on the institution's funding and infrastructure.
How can I verify if a college's placement claims are real?
Cross-reference placement brochures with official NIRF data and search for alumni profiles on LinkedIn to confirm their current job roles.
